摘要
Known as physical color, structural color is produced by the interaction between the micro- /nano-structure and visible light. Because of the distinguishing chromatic mechanism of physical and chemical colors, the optical performance of structural color is significantly different from that of organic dyes and pigments. The essence of structural color is a visual effect produced by the diffraction, interference and scattering effect between the special periodic structure and visible light. At present, the main way of textile coloring is to graft or apply dyes or pigments on fibers and fabrics. To overcome the poor light fastness and environmental problems of organic dyes and pigments, people devoted to use structural colors with excellent optical properties in the field of textile printing and dyeing replacing traditional organic dyes. In this paper, the chromatic mechanism of structural color, preparation and assembly methods of structural color materials, and latest research progress of structural color materials for textile printing and dyeing were reviewed. Finally, the future research directions in this field were analyzed, and the key problems were pointed out, so as to promote the development and application of structural color materials in the textile field. © 2022, Editorial Board of Polymer Materials Science & Engineering.
